I'm running Telegram bot and noticed the free memory degradation when running bot for a long time. Firstly, I suspect my code; then I suspect bot and finally I came to requests. :)
I used len(gc.get_objects()) to identify that problem exists. I located the communication routines, then cleared all bot code and comes to the example that raises the count of gc objects on every iteration.
Expected Result
len(gc.get_objects()) should give the same result on every loop iteration
Actual Result
The value of len(gc.get_objects()) increases on every loop iteration.
Test N2
GetObjects len: 27959
Test N3
GetObjects len: 27960
Test N4
GetObjects len: 27961
Test N5
GetObjects len: 27962
Test N6
GetObjects len: 27963
Test N7
GetObjects len: 27964
Reproduction Steps
token = "XXX:XXX"
chat_id = '111'
proxy = {'https':'socks5h://ZZZ'} #You may need proxy to run this in Russia
from time import sleep
import gc, requests
def garbage_info():
res = ""
res += "\nGetObjects len: " + str(len(gc.get_objects()))
return res
def tester():
count = 0
while(True):
sleep(1)
count += 1
msg = "\nTest N{0}".format(count) + garbage_info()
print(msg)
method_url = r'sendMessage'
payload = {'chat_id': str(chat_id), 'text': msg}
request_url = "https://api.telegram.org/bot{0}/{1}".format(token, method_url)
method_name = 'get'
session = requests.session()
req = requests.Request(
method=method_name.upper(),
url=request_url,
params=payload
)
prep = session.prepare_request(req)
settings = session.merge_environment_settings(
prep.url, None, None, None, None)
# prep.url, proxy, None, None, None) #Change the line to enable proxy
send_kwargs = {
'timeout': None,
'allow_redirects': None,
}
send_kwargs.update(settings)
resp = session.send(prep, **send_kwargs)
# For more clean output
gc.collect()
tester()
